Standard Bible Encyclopedia SKULL skul (gulgoleth; kranion): The Hebrew word, which is well known to Bible readers in its Aramaic-Greek form "Golgotha," expresses the more or less globular shape of the human skull, being derived from a root meaning "to roll." It is often translated in English Versions of the Bible by "head," "poll," etc. In the meaning "skull" it is found twice (Judges 9:53 2 Kings 9:35). In the New Testament the word is found only in connection with GOLGOTHA (which see), "the place of a skull" (Matthew 27:33 Mark 15:22 John 19:17), or "the skull" (Luke 23:33). |  | Multi-Version Concordance Skull (7 Occurrences) Matthew 27:33 They came to a place called "Golgotha," that is to say, "The place of a skull."
